In 2018 Nick Vedros was honored to be included in Portrait Americana: A 100+ Years of American portrait photography at the Albrecht Kemper Museum.
He was asked to join the Hasselblad University faculty, and was chosen by Eastman Kodak for a lecture tour including the United States, China, Korea, Malaysia, the Philippines, New Zealand, and Australia. Vedros has lectured for Apple in 14 cities throughout America. Nick continues to lecture nationally.
Nick Vedros has a reputation for going the extra mile for his clients. He has been recognized twice as one of the Top 200 Advertising Photographers globally, and was one of the original members of the exclusive Canon Explorers of Light.
Nick Vedros also has a reputation for going the extra mile for his fellow photographers. He is the founding President of the Midwest chapter of ASMP.
“I put four sides around an idea.” It is a deceptively simple phrase to sum up three decades of international award-winning photography for a client list which includes Apple, McDonalds, Bayer, Capital One, Qualcomm, Coca-Cola, DuPont, IBM, Microsoft, Sony, Mastercard, and Sprint.

ABOUT:
In the hazy, warm New York summer, little is more refreshing than reclining on the beach in the mist of the icy ocean waves or enjoying a family trip to the country house. Each summer, Rice curates her favorite show, the Summertime Salon, which reminds us of this exact seasonal sentiment. The two, long walls of the gallery become mosaicked, top to bottom, side to side, in photographs that evoke all the preeminent feelings and memories of summer. Each year, the Summertime Salon matures and Rice’s annual masterpiece comes into fruition. This year is no exception. The show is a haven of what the Robin Rice Gallery stands for, a community of art and experience.
As the largest annual exhibition, the Summertime Salon is carefully pieced together, the results are staggering. The works of the 53 gallery artists come together communally, reinforcing the overall sense of unity that the show creates as a whole. In knowing the photographs so fluently, Rice strategically places them together in a way that will enhance the individual stories contained in each. Details from one image flow from into the next, elevating every photograph in a distinctly unique way.
This year’s invitational image, “Surf Club” by Silvia Lareo-Vasquez, features a woman in a vintage sun hat reclining in the pool with a drink. The black and white image evokes an extreme sense of nostalgia in its cinematic portraiture and supple texture. Though the figure of the woman is tauntingly beautiful, the drink is the darkest tone, nearing black, and is centered in the frame. With this, we are reminded of the refreshing notes of summer and the utter serenity of taking the day off to relax.
